众所周知,门户网站属于一种应用系统,它为某些综合性物联网信息资源提供服务的,比如国外着名的谷歌和雅虎,以及中国的百度、网易等等。一般门户网站的建设要求...
2024-11-13 31 门户网站建设
随着互联网技术的飞速发展,服务器作为网络服务的核心支撑,其稳定性和性能直接关系到用户体验的优劣,在实际应用过程中,用户时常会遇到“Server is too busy”(服务器繁忙)的提示,这既影响了用户的正常使用,也对企业的业务连续性和声誉构成了挑战,本文旨在深入探讨“Server is too busy”这一现象背后的原因、带来的影响以及有效的应对策略,以期为相关从业者提供参考与借鉴。
一、“Server is too busy”的含义
“Server is too busy”直译为“服务器太忙”,它通常出现在用户尝试访问某个网络服务或资源时,由于服务器当前负载过高,无法及时响应新的请求,从而向用户反馈的一种状态信息,这种提示表明服务器正在处理大量的并发请求,已达到或超过其承载能力上限,导致无法立即为新用户提供服务。
二、造成“Server is too busy”的原因
1. 高并发访问:当大量用户在同一时间段内集中访问某一特定服务或资源时,如电商平台的大促活动、社交媒体的热点事件等,会引发短时间内的高并发请求,超出服务器的处理能力。
2. 资源瓶颈:服务器硬件资源(如CPU、内存、磁盘I/O、网络带宽等)不足,无法满足日益增长的业务需求,导致处理速度下降,出现繁忙状态。
3. 软件性能问题:应用程序设计不合理、存在性能瓶颈、未进行充分的压力测试或优化,可能导致在高负载下运行效率低下,增加服务器负担。
4. 系统故障或攻击:服务器遭受DDoS攻击、系统故障、配置错误等问题,也可能导致服务器无法正常处理请求,表现为“busy”状态。
三、“Server is too busy”带来的影响
1. 用户体验受损:用户在遭遇“Server is too busy”提示时,往往需要等待较长时间才能获得响应,甚至可能因超时而放弃操作,严重影响用户体验和满意度。
2. 业务损失:对于电商、金融、在线教育等依赖实时交互的行业,服务器繁忙可能导致交易失败、客户流失、品牌形象受损等直接经济损失。
3. 运维压力增大:频繁出现的服务器繁忙问题会增加运维团队的工作负担,需要投入更多资源进行故障排查、性能调优、应急扩容等工作。
四、应对“Server is too busy”的策略
1. 弹性扩展:利用云计算平台的弹性伸缩功能,根据业务需求动态调整服务器资源,如增加实例数量、提升配置规格等,以应对突发的高并发访问。
2. 性能优化:对应用程序进行性能剖析,识别并解决性能瓶颈;采用缓存、异步处理、负载均衡等技术手段提高系统处理能力;定期进行压力测试,确保系统在高负载下的稳定性。
3. 安全防护:部署防火墙、入侵检测系统等安全设备,防范DDOS攻击;定期更新补丁、修复漏洞,降低系统故障风险。
4. 用户体验设计:在用户界面上提供友好的等待提示或排队机制,让用户了解当前状态并预估等待时间;对于重要操作,可考虑设置重试机制或提供备用方案。
5. 监控与预警:建立完善的服务器监控系统,实时监测各项性能指标,如CPU使用率、内存占用、请求队列长度等;设置合理的阈值,一旦发现异常立即触发预警,以便运维人员及时介入处理。
“Server is too busy”是网络服务中常见的一种现象,其背后反映了服务器在面对高并发、资源瓶颈、软件性能问题、系统故障或攻击等情况时的应对挑战,通过理解其含义、分析原因、评估影响以及采取针对性的应对策略,可以有效提升服务器的稳定性和服务质量,保障用户的良好体验和企业业务的顺畅运行,在数字化转型加速的今天,如何高效应对“Server is too busy”,已成为每个互联网企业必须面对的重要课题。
TAG:servers are too busy
相关文章